The lowest solid gold alloy used in jewelry is 10k gold. It is made up of 41.7 percent actual gold and 58.3% other metals. Is 10K gold good for everyday wear? If you're looking for jewelry to wear every day, 10K gold might be the best option because it's more robust and scratch-resistant than other karat weights.
Is 10K or 14K heavier?
Weight. An object made of 10K gold will weight less than an equal-size object made of 14K gold. This is because gold is heavier than other metals that are mixed with it and 14K contains more gold.
45 related questions foundWill 10k gold turn green?
There are different types of gold, including 10k, 14k, and 24k. A common karat used in jewelry is 10k, and unfortunately yes 10K gold will turn green. 10k gold is 41.7% gold and 58.3% alloy metals and the other alloys are not resistant to corrosion like gold.

Is 10K white gold better than 14K?
10K white gold has the lowest purity and contains about 41.7% gold (10/24ths). 14K white gold is purer – 58.3% of this alloy consists of gold. 18K white gold has the highest purity – 75% of it, or 3/4ths, is pure gold.

Is 18k gold heavier than 10K?
While all gold rings will scratch and scuff over time due to the soft nature of precious metals, you'll find that the gold content in 10k and 14k is slightly harder than in 18k; however, 18k is a denser, and therefore, heavier metal and will feel a bit more substantial on your finger.
